Block
#12,725,315
28w
19 txs862,680 confs
Transactions
19
Total Output
₳14,826,169.41
$2.24M
Fees
₳6.19
Size
17.61 KB
18,034 bytes
Details
Hash
75ac03ba70a7d5224d8f56b2e27584269c8b89cb9d53908e92d4b39fb4b03e71
Epoch / Slot
Epoch 598 · slot 173,132,719 · epoch-slot 159,919
Timestamp
28w · Tue, 02 Dec 2025 18:10:10 GMT
Block producer
VRF key
vrf_vk1d…zq3wsmhv
Op cert
946a0307…34943a9e
Op cert counter
6
Transactions in block19